Our review
🧭 Overall Course Rating: 3.80/5 - Recent reviews only considered.
Course Review Synthesis
Pros:
- The instructor has a strong understanding of the subject matter, which is evident throughout the course. (Multiple reviews)
- The length of the lectures is advantageous for mobile device users, as it facilitates learning in shorter sessions. (One review)
- The instructor deserves commendation for their initiative and effort in creating educational content. (Several reviews)
- Some aspects of the course, such as the initial sections on web development, were engaging and potentially useful for learners. (One review)
- Acknowledgment that the course offers a valuable learning experience for those interested in consuming a web service with Android using Xamarin. (One review)
Cons:
- There is a notable repetition of content, with the instructor frequently promoting other courses as prerequisites, which can be seen as an attempt to cross-sell rather than providing a complete learning experience within the course itself. (Multiple reviews)
- The course contains technical issues, including server errors and problems with platform-at-rest (PAU) resolution that resulted in lost instructional time. (One review)
- The course's focus on C# leaves out important Xamarin multi-platform capabilities, focusing solely on Android and neglecting iOS or Windows mobile development. (One review)
- There is a limited number of API call examples provided, with only two instances for logging in and user creation. (One review)
- The course's structure requires prior completion of another course by the same instructor as a prerequisite, which was not clearly communicated before purchase. This creates dependency and inconvenience for learners. (Several reviews)
- There may be outdated content, with some reviews indicating that the material covers versions from 2015 or 2017 and has not been updated to reflect current practices or technologies. (One review)
Additional Notes:
- Learners should be made aware of necessary prerequisites before purchasing the course to avoid confusion and ensure a complete learning experience.
- The instructor's approach to linking courses as prerequisites could be reconsidered to provide a more comprehensive learning path within a single purchase.
- Technical issues such as server errors and installation problems need to be resolved to optimize the learning experience and avoid losing valuable instructional time.
- Providing more examples and a wider range of practical applications, particularly for API calls beyond login and user creation, would enhance the course's utility.
- The course content should be reviewed and updated regularly to ensure that it aligns with the latest technologies and industry practices.
Recommendation: For those interested in learning about integrating a Xamarin application with a web service, this course has potential value, especially for Android development. However, learners should consider the above-mentioned issues and ensure they have completed any necessary prerequisites to avoid frustration and achieve a more enriching experience. It is advisable for the instructor to address these concerns to improve the course's quality and relevance.
